Key Equipment for Construction Waste Processing

1. Jaw Crusher
Jaw crushers are ideal for primary crushing of construction waste, breaking large chunks into manageable sizes. Their robust design ensures high efficiency and durability when handling hard materials like concrete and reinforced concrete.

2. Impact Crusher
For secondary crushing, impact crushers provide excellent particle shaping capabilities. They are particularly effective for processing demolition waste, producing well-graded aggregates suitable for road bases and concrete production.

3. Cone Crusher
When fine crushing is required, cone crushers deliver high-quality output with low flakiness. They are commonly used in high-capacity sand-making lines to produce uniform-sized aggregates.

4. Mobile Crushing Plant
Mobile crushing stations offer flexibility for on-site processing, eliminating the need for transportation of bulky waste materials. These plants are equipped with feeders, crushers, and screens, making them ideal for urban demolition projects.

5. Sand Maker (VSI Crusher)
Sand makers are essential for producing high-quality manufactured sand from crushed construction waste. The vertical shaft impact crusher ensures excellent grain shape, meeting the stringent requirements of modern concrete and asphalt mixes.

6. Vibrating Screen
Screening equipment separates crushed materials into different sizes, ensuring only properly sized aggregates proceed to the next stage. Multi-layer screens improve classification accuracy.

Benefits of Recycling Construction Waste

Recycling construction waste reduces landfill dependency, lowers material costs, and minimizes environmental pollution. Processed aggregates can replace natural sand and gravel in various applications, including road construction, concrete production, and backfilling.

FAQ: Common Questions About Construction Waste Recycling

Q: What types of construction waste can be recycled?
A: Common recyclable materials include concrete, bricks, asphalt, tiles, and metal scraps. These can be crushed and repurposed as aggregates for new construction projects.

Q: What is the typical output size of processed construction waste?
A: Depending on the crushing equipment, output sizes range from 0-5mm (sand), 5-20mm (fine aggregate), and 20-40mm (coarse aggregate). Adjustable settings allow customization based on project requirements.
